Hundreds of Arabs and Jews protested near the Wadi Ara region on Saturday against the expansion of the ultra-Orthodox city Harish. The participants carried posters saying: "Don't bring the haredim here," and "No to occupation of lands."
In July Interior Minister Eli Yishai approved a new construction plan for the city Harish, which is to be built in the Wadi Ara region. Some 8,800 new housing units, employment centers, public buildings and educational institutions are to be built as part of the plan, to fulfill the needs of the ultra-Orthodox population.
